Airship mooring system secured to the vessel's casing with "crow's feet" arrangement.

This below declaration of company name and address should be sufficient to establish the identity (or at lease very close relationship) of Société de Constructions Aéronautiques with Société anonyme Astra later filing at the same address:

We "Astra" Societe de Constructions Aeronautiques, Anciens Establissements Surcouf, of 121 to 123, rue de Bellevue, Billancourt (Seine), France, do hereby declare ...
